Image Annotation

Encord Computer Vision Glossary

Image annotation

Image annotation is the process of labeling or annotating an image with metadata or additional information about the content of the image. This can involve adding text labels or tags to describe the objects, people, or scenes depicted in the image, as well as drawing bounding boxes or other shapes around specific objects or regions of interest.

In the field of computer vision, image annotation is a typical activity that is frequently used to produce training and validation datasets for machine learning algorithms. For instance, if a machine learning model is being created to categorize pictures of animals, the training dataset's pictures must be tagged with terms like cat, dog, or bird. Afterward, the model would be trained on this dataset, and its performance would be assessed based on its capacity to accurately classify brand-new, untried photos.

Manual annotation, semi-automatic annotation, and fully automated annotation are just a few of the several methods that can be utilized to do image annotation. The most accurate and reliable annotations can be obtained through human annotation, which entails carefully evaluating and identifying each image in the collection. Fully automated annotation uses algorithms to create the annotations automatically, whereas semi-automated annotation uses tools to speed up the manual annotation process.

Overall, image annotation is a crucial step in the development and evaluation of machine learning models for image analysis and recognition tasks. It allows practitioners to create datasets that are tailored to the specific needs of their models, and enables the models to learn from real-world examples and improve their accuracy and performance.

Scale your annotation workflows and power your model performance with data-driven insights
medical banner

What is image annotation for computer vision?

In the field of computer vision, image annotation is a typical activity that is frequently used to produce training and validation datasets for machine learning algorithms. For instance, if a machine learning model is being created to categorize pictures of animals, the training dataset's pictures must be tagged with terms like cat, dog, or bird. Afterward, the model would be trained on this dataset, and its performance would be assessed based on its capacity to accurately classify brand-new, untried photos.

Manual annotation, semi-automatic annotation, and fully automated annotation are just a few of the several methods that can be utilized to do image annotation. The most accurate and reliable annotations can be obtained through human annotation, which entails carefully evaluating and identifying each image in the collection. Fully automated annotation uses algorithms to create the annotations automatically, whereas semi-automated annotation uses tools to speed up the manual annotation process.

Overall, image annotation is a crucial step in the development and evaluation of machine learning models for image analysis and recognition tasks. It allows practitioners to create datasets that are tailored to the specific needs of their models, and enables the models to learn from real-world examples and improve their accuracy and performance.\

cta banner

Discuss this blog on Slack

Join the Encord Developers community to discuss the latest in computer vision, machine learning, and data-centric AI

Join the community
cta banner

Automate 97% of your annotation tasks with 99% accuracy